1 SQL2008 表达式:是常量、变量、列或函数等与运算符的任意组合。
2 1. 字符串函数
3 函数 名称 参数 示例 说明
4 ascii(字符串表达式)
5 select ascii('abc') 返回 97
6 返回字符串中最左侧的字符的ASCII 码。
7 char(整数表达式)
8 select char(100) 返回 d
9 把ASCII 码转换为
转载
2023-11-27 15:09:27
78阅读
前言 问题描述:在表列里有肉眼不可见字符,导致一些更新或插入失败。 几年前第一次碰见这种问题是在读取考勤机人员信息时碰见的,折腾了一点时间,现在又碰到了还有点新发现就顺便一起记录下。 如下图所示 golds字段 看上去5个字符,长度则为44 ,可判断有特殊字符存在此列中。 基础知识准备贴几个常用函数 1、获取字符的ASCII码 ASCII ASCII码是对字符的标准编码。
转载
2024-01-25 20:44:07
1054阅读
Ord函数 序数函数,函数返回值为字符在ASCII码中的序号。 如:ord(‘a’)=97,ord(‘0’)=48,ord(true)=1 。 Char(97)=a ASCII码表ASCII值控制字符ASCII值控制字符ASCII值控制字符ASCII值控制字符0 NUT 32 (space) 64 @ 96 、1 SOH 33 !65 A 97 a 2 S
转载
2024-08-12 09:06:42
116阅读
在使用 SQL Server 的过程中,可能会遇到“空格 ASCII 码”相关的问题。这种问题通常出现在数据处理和查询过程中,导致无法有效识别和存储数据。探讨这个问题,我们可以从多个方面进行深入分析,包括业务场景、演进历程、架构设计、性能优化、故障复盘以及扩展应用。
## 背景定位
在许多业务场景中,数据存储的整洁和准确性至关重要。例如,用户输入的名称、地址或备注等字段可能包含额外的空格,这会
在SQL Server中,我们经常需要将ASCII码转换为对应的字符串。这个过程虽然简单,但在实际操作中可能涉及到一些复杂的技术细节。此外,保证数据的完整性和有效性同样重要,因此在处理这些数据时,制定相应的备份策略、恢复流程、大灾难场景应对策略、工具链集成、迁移方案以及最佳实践都是不可或缺的。以下是对这些内容的系统梳理与记录。
### 备份策略
备份数据是保护数据安全的首要步骤。以下是我们的备份
很多程序员视 SQL 为洪水猛兽。SQL 是一种为数不多的声明性语言,它的运行方式完全不同于我们所熟知的命令行语言、面向对象的程序语言、甚至是函数语言(尽管有些人认为 SQL 语言也是一种函数式语言)。我们每天都在写 SQL 并且应用在开源软件 jOOQ 中。于是我想把 SQL 之美介绍给那些仍然对它头疼不已的朋友,所以本文是为了以下读者而特地编写的:1、 在工作中会用到 SQL 但是对它并不完全
public static int Asc(string character) { if (character.Length == 1) { System.Text.ASCIIEncodi...
转载
2008-09-07 16:58:00
324阅读
2评论
我们在开发使时常会用到资源文件,这可能是为了多语言、国际化的需要,也可能是使用了国外开源项目的原因,这就需要将中文转换为ASCII编码,或者将ASCII转换为中文。那么我们就可以使用JDK自带的转换工具native2ascii。 一、中文转换为ASCII编码用法一:打开目录:C:\Program Files\Java\jdk1.8.0_141\bin可能你自己的JDK目录和版本不一样在文
转载
2023-05-24 15:27:24
2225阅读
内容为个人学习心得,不能对准确性做过多保证,错误之处还望指点。有时候我们会遇到一些\u开头的字符串,例如\u4f60\u597d,我们知道这些是Unicode码,一段\uxxxx字符串对应了一个Unicode字符。那这些编码字符的实际二进制存储格式是怎样呢?我们知道Unicode编码可以呈现世界上大部分的文字内容,而在其最通用的一种编码方式UTF-8)下,单字符的存储长度为1-4字节(可变),这种
转载
2023-10-18 20:17:50
106阅读
public static int Asc(string character) { if (character.Length == 1) { System.Text.ASCIIEncoding asciiEncoding = new System.Text.ASCIIEncoding(); int intAsciiCode = (int)asciiEnco
原创
2021-07-30 14:50:37
822阅读
计算机发明后,为了在计算机中表示字符,人们制定了一种编码,叫ASCII码。ASCII码由一个字节中的7位(bit)表示,范围是0x00 - 0x7F 共128个字符。
后来他们突然发现,如果需要按照表格方式打印这些字符的时候,缺少了“制表符”。于是又扩展了ASCII的定义,使用一个字节的全部8位(bit)来表示字符了,这就叫扩展ASCII码。范围是0x00 - 0xFF 共256个字符。
转载
2023-08-26 22:38:41
97阅读
同事在开发项目时使用了eclipse国际化插件,他的目的就是处理乱码,这样一来,他输入中文,插件会给他自动转换为Unicode编码,形如:“\u51fa\u54c1\”,总监审查代码时看到这些异样符合颇为生气,说代码可读性差,要他改回来。还好他的中文都写在ApplicationResources_zh_CN.propertie
转载
2023-10-25 22:26:45
98阅读
鲁迅曾经说没有被编码格式困扰过的程序员注定留有遗憾常言道常在路上跑哪能不摔倒摔倒快起身躺着睡更好书归正传躺归躺闹归闹决不能拿写代码开玩笑毕竟我代码很大 健壮你忍一下~~~~~~~~~~~~~~优雅~~~~~~~~~~~~~~一、ASCII码 首先熟悉下,什么叫ASCII码?想要直接看代码的小伙伴直接跳过,看第三部分。 &nb
转载
2023-11-03 18:06:54
242阅读
# SQL Server ASCII码 特殊字符解码
在SQL Server中,ASCII码是一种常见的字符编码方式。每个字符都有一个对应的ASCII码值,用于在计算机中表示和存储字符。然而,有时候我们需要将特殊字符进行解码,以便能够正确地处理它们。
## ASCII码和特殊字符
ASCII码是一个7位的字符编码标准,定义了128个字符的对应关系。其中包括了标准的英文字母、数字、标点符号,以
原创
2024-01-23 09:14:09
426阅读
# SQL Server 查询特殊字符的 ASCII 码
在数据库管理中,字符编码和处理是不可避免的任务之一。尤其是在 SQL Server 中,有时我们需要查询和处理特殊字符。为了方便处理,了解这些字符的 ASCII 码是非常有帮助的。本文将介绍如何在 SQL Server 中查询特殊字符的 ASCII 码,并提供相应的代码示例。
## ASCII 码简介
ASCII(American S
ASCII码的介绍:目前计算机中用得最广泛的字符集及其编码,是由美国国家标准局(ANSI)制定的ASCII码(American Standard Code for Information Interchange,美国标准信息交换码),它已被国际标准化组织(ISO)定为国际标准,称为ISO 646标准。适用于所有拉丁文字字母,ASCII码有7位码和8位码两种形式。因为1位二进制数可以表示(21=)2
转载
2023-07-25 19:27:10
111阅读
在C语言中,ASCII码转字符非常简单。但是之前因为没有用到就没有去关注这方面的问题。 printf("%c\n",char(69)); E 下面是ASCII码表:BinDecHex缩写/字符解释0000 0000000NUL(null)空
原创
2021-07-27 21:46:49
1404阅读
# JAVA转ASCII码的实现
## 1. 流程图
下面是实现JAVA转ASCII码的流程图:
```mermaid
pie
"输入字符串" : 20
"将字符串转为字符数组" : 20
"遍历字符数组" : 20
"将字符转为ASCII码" : 20
"输出ASCII码" : 20
```
## 2. 实现步骤
### 步骤1:输入字符串
首
原创
2023-11-10 08:05:08
47阅读
字符转 ASCII 码//字符转 ASCII 码//1.如下是转换单个字符 //#include <std
原创
2022-06-09 01:47:30
384阅读
# 在Android中实现字符转ASCII码的教程
在Android开发中,可能会遇到将字符转为ASCII码的需求。这看似简单,但对于初学者而言,理解整个流程和代码可能会有些困难。本篇文章将带你了解如何在Android中实现这一功能,并通过示例代码逐步指导你。
## 1. 整体流程
以下是实现“Android字符转ASCII码”的基本步骤:
| 步骤 | 描述 |
| ---- | ---